Job Summary
Under general supervision, the RN will provide nursing care in one of OU Health’s specialty areas.
Essential Responsibilities
- Assume responsibility for an assigned group of patients.
- Document patient responses to nursing interventions and prescribed medical treatments; note all changes in physician orders for assigned patients.
- Assist physicians in the examination of patients and in performing minor diagnostic procedures and treatments.
- Obtain and monitor physiological data of patients; observe physiological manifestations and intervene when necessary.
- Administer medication as prescribed.
- Initiate, regulate, and monitor intravenous infusions and blood products.
- Deliver patient care competently.
- Interact with family and patients to share care plans during hospitalization and at discharge.
- Oversee treatment provided by technicians or other service providers.
- Inform patients and families of hospital procedures.
- Make referrals regarding patient care needs to appropriate personnel.
- Delegate tasks to support staff.
Required Skills & Experience
- Knowledge of professional nursing theory, practices, techniques, and procedures.
- Ability to organize, plan, coordinate, and evaluate nursing services and apply nursing techniques.
- Ability to maintain good working relationships with other employees.
- Good verbal and written communication skills.
- Ability to respond effectively to cultural and language needs of patients and visitors.
- Some computer skills.
- Ability to work effectively as part of a team providing excellent specialized care.
- May require completion of orientation and ability to function independently in the assigned specialty area prior to being assigned to this position.

About Oklahoma City, OK
As a Travel Interventional Radiology Nurse in Oklahoma City, OK here's what you should know:Cost of Living
- The cost of living in Oklahoma City is lower than the national average, making it an affordable place to live.
- Wages generally match up with the lower cost of living.
Weather
- Summer average high: 93°F, average low: 71°F.
- Winter average high: 49°F, average low: 28°F.
Furnished Housing
- Short term rentals are available and relatively easy to find in Oklahoma City.
Transportation
- Oklahoma City is car-friendly, and public transportation options include buses and a streetcar system.
Demographics
- The city has a diverse population with a wide age range.
- Common health issues include obesity and related conditions.
- Oklahoma City has a growing population of travel nurses.
Things to Do
- Oklahoma City offers a variety of restaurants, art galleries, music venues, and sports events.
-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y parks, lakes, and hiking trails.
